COMMERCIAL.

Press Assn. —By telegraph—Copyright. (Received March 19, 8.30 a.m.) LONDON, March 18. liank of England returns : Gold coin £23,112,000, reserve £24,943,000; proportion of reserve to liabilities, 49.32; circulation, £27,903,000; public deposits, £9,644,000; other deposits, £40,896,000; Government securities, £13,976,000 j other securities, £29,891,000. Three months' bills, 3 9 I*s ; short loans, 3j } . Consols, 81-g. New South Wales fours 106!. New Zealand three and a lialfs, 98 J. Westralian three and a lialfs, 98&. Tasmanian threes 86*. llic rest arc unchanged. Copper, three months, £59 Is 3d. Tin, spot, £143 15s; three months, £145 17s 6d. Sugar, German, 14s 6d, first marks 16s 6d. Bradford » ool—Merino strong, crossbred quiet. Common sixties 271, super 28. At London sales, Wairere average 10-Jd; Tukoranga 12} d, average HJd. There is a strong market for all classes of wool. The wheat markets are steady, with a quiet demand for cargoes, and no speculation. Victorian MarchApril 38s 9d, 14,000 quarters South Australian, and Victorian FebruaryMarch 395. Holders are asking '3Bs 3d for steamer parcels afloat, and 37s 9d for March-April. There is little enquiry for Australian spot at about 42s 9d.

Oats are quiet, Laplata April-May 14s Id to 14s l^d. The butter market is slow, and the high prices are checking business. The warmer weather is also having an effect, though Continental supplies are still insignificant. Danish 130s and 1345, Australian choicest 1245, secondary 120s; New Zealand choicest, 1265; Argentine, 1245. Olieese firm ; New Zealand 60s and 625.

(Received March 19, 10.15 a.m.) LONDON, March 18. There were 570 cases of kaui-i gum offered, and 205 sold at full rates.
